titleOfInvention | High-cottonseed-meal carp compound feed and preparation method thereof |
abstract | The invention discloses a high-cottonseed-meal carp compound feed and a preparation method thereof, wherein each raw material in the compound feed and the percentage by weight thereof are as follows: 6.0% of fish meal, 15.2% of wheat middling, 11.00% of DDGS (distillers dried grains with soluble), 10.0% of bean pulp, 33.0% of cottonseed meal, 14.0% of rapeseed meal, 6.0% of rice bran meal, 2.0% of corn oil, 0.16% of table salt, 1.6% of monocalcium phosphate, 0.15% of choline, 0.39% of lysine, 0.05% of threonine, 0.2% of vitamins for fish, 0.2% of minerals for fish and 0.05% of aquatic product composite enzyme. The preparation method comprises the following steps of smashing, mixing, superfine smashing, granulating and spraying. The high-cottonseed-meal carp compound feed and the preparation method thereof provided by the invention have the advantages that the nutrition requirement of the carp is met, the feed intake of the carp is ensured, the weight increment rate of the carp is improved, meanwhile, the feed cost is lowered obviously, and the cultivation benefit is improved. |
